Betty Isabelle Mitchell Cox is the daughter of Harold Webster Mitchell and Lena Doris Munson Mitchell. She married William Harry Cox on 5 Nov 1955 in West Stockholm, NY. She has 5 children.

Betty M. Cox
THURSDAY, JUNE 21, 2012

Potsdam- Funeral services for 78 year old Betty Mitchell Cox of Churchville, and formerly of Potsdam, will be held Friday, June 22, 2012 at 11:00 AM at the Seymour Funeral Home in Potsdam with Rev. Kenneth Pell Pastor of the Potsdam Church of the Nazarene officiating with Gary Jones co-officiating. Burial will follow in the Sanfordville Cemetery. Friends may call at the Seymour Funeral Home in Potsdam on Thursday afternoon and Thursday evening from 2:00 to 4:00 and 7:00 to 9:00 PM. Mrs. Cox died Sunday June 17th at Unity Hospital in Rochester.

Survivors include two sons Phillip Stanley Cox of Taberg, NY, Wayne Charles Cox of Massena, a daughter Beth Anne Benner of Round Hill VA, and seven grandchildren Katherine Cox, Zachary Cox, Tracy Cox, Laura Beth Benner, Danielle Cox, Nicholas Cox, and Mikayla Benner.
Five brothers Lawrence Mitchell of Potsdam, James Mitchell of Norwood, Kenneth Mitchell of Waddington, Mark Mitchell of Halifax, MA, Ronald Mitchell of Canton, and five sisters Doris Hunt of Potsdam, Letha Chase of Potsdam, Ann MacAdam of Sacramento, CA, Kay Ramsay of Potsdam, and Carolyn Mitchell of Madrid, also survive. Betty was pre-deceased by two sons Daniel William Cox and Daryl Edward Cox.

Betty was born in the Town of Stockholm, NY on March 19, 1934 the daughter of Harold Webster and Lena Doris (Munson) Mitchell. She graduated from Potsdam High School and worked for the EE and CC Greene Lumber Mill in Sanfordville for many years as a bookkeeper. She later worked for the Martin's Maple Street Service Station as a bookkeeper.

Betty was a member of the Potsdam Church of the Nazarene. If friends desire memorials may be made to the Church of the Nazarene in her memory. Arrangements are with the Seymour Funeral Home in Potsdam.
